Mahindra & Mahindra Ltd. is an Indian multinational company, part of the Mahindra Group, renowned for producing tractors, SUVs, commercial vehicles, electric vehicles, and defense products, serving agriculture, transportation, and industrial sectors worldwide.
Mahindra & Mahindra Ltd. (M&M), founded in 1945 by brothers JC Mahindra and KC Mahindra alongside Malik Ghulam Muhammad, has become one of India’s most respected multinational automotive manufacturers. Headquartered in Mumbai, M&M began by assembling Willys Jeeps under license before expanding into tractors, commercial vehicles, and agricultural machinery. Today, under the leadership of Anish Shah, M&M is a key player in automotive, farm equipment, and technology innovation, known globally for its rugged utility vehicles, advanced tractors, and sustainable mobility solutions.
Early on, Mahindra focused on producing durable, affordable vehicles for India’s challenging terrain and developing agricultural equipment to empower small and marginal farmers. With factories spread across India, the US, and Africa, Mahindra’s production capacity exceeds 300,000 tractors and 700,000 vehicles annually. Key product milestones include the introduction of the Mahindra B-275 tractor in 1963, the bestselling Mahindra 575 DI, and the TREO electric three-wheeler. Mahindra has diversified into electric mobility, precision agriculture, and smart farming solutions, backed by strategic collaborations such as its OEM partnership with Mitsubishi and financing ties with Mahindra Finance, making it a leader in India’s industrial landscape.
The Mahindra tractor story began in the early 1960s when the company partnered with International Harvester to bring modern agricultural machinery to Indian farmers. The launch of the Mahindra B-275 tractor in 1963 marked a transformative moment, providing farmers with reliable, high-performing equipment tailored to Indian conditions. Over the decades, Mahindra expanded its lineup to include the 475 DI, 575 DI, and the powerful Arjun Novo series, meeting diverse farm sizes and applications.
By the 2000s, Mahindra had become the world’s largest tractor manufacturer by volume, with exports reaching over 40 countries, including the US, China, and Africa. In 2015, Mahindra’s acquisition of Mitsubishi Agricultural Machinery further enhanced its technological capabilities. Flagship plants in Mumbai, Jaipur, and Rajkot now serve global markets, reflecting Mahindra’s commitment to innovation, quality, and customer-centricity. This rich history ensures today’s operators benefit from decades of research, field testing, and farmer feedback, making Mahindra tractors a symbol of strength and trust.
